Recycle your Christmas Tree
Gulfport has a simple option for people looking to recycle their trees.

Christmas is done and over with, but the tree may still be up. Keeping it up through until the new year is common, but it's going to have to come down at some point.
The Pinellas County Utilities website has a list of the areas that will help recycle your tree, rather than just destroying it.
Before recycling your tree, the utilities department asks that you clean your tree of all ornaments and put it in a accessible area for pickup. The tree shouldn't be put in a bag or bin for pick up.

- Gulfport: Put in in the curbside collection with yard waste on Wednesdays. Call 893-1089.
If you feel like making the drive to make sure it's recycled, anyone can drop a tree off at the Pinellas County Solid Waste facility, 3095 114th Ave. N., St. Petersburg. The trees will be recycled into mulch to be given away free to the public. The cost is $3 per load for a maximum of five trees. If you have friends and family with their own trees to get rid of, it makes sense to work together.
